Barnhälsovårdssjuksköterskans preventiva arbete för barn med feber: En intervjustudie
Halmstad University, School of Health and Welfare.
Halmstad University, School of Health and Welfare.
2024 (Swedish)Independent thesis Advanced level (degree of Master (One Year)), 10 credits / 15 HE creditsStudent thesisAlternative title
The Child Health Care Nurse's Preventive Work for Children with Fever : An Interview Study (English)
Abstract [sv]

Bakgrund: Hos barn i åldern noll till fem år är feber ett vanligt symtom vid sjukdom. Det är därför viktigt att vårdnadshavare förstår betydelsen av egenvård för att kunna ta hand om sitt barn i sin hemmiljö. Syfte: Syftet var att belysa barnhälsovårdssjuksköterskans preventiva arbete för barn med feber. Metod: Vald metod var kvalitativ design med induktiv ansats. Intervjuer av 11 specialistutbildade sjuksköterskor innefattande distriktssköterskor samt sjuksköterskor med specialistutbildning inom hälso- och sjukvård av barn och ungdomar. Barnhälsovårdssjuksköterskor (BHV-sjuksköterskor) i både privat samt regional regi deltog från två Halländska kommuner. Resultat: Tre kategorier: Information till vårdnadshavare, stöd till vårdnadshavare och egenvårdsrådgivning utgjorde resultatet. Därefter tillkom underkategorier. Likvärdigt resultat har kunnat ses hos deltagande BHV-sjuksköterskor. Konklusion: Slutsatsen var att majoriteten av BHV-sjuksköterskorna ansåg att det fanns ett stort behov av egenvårdsutbildning om barn med feber för vårdnadshavare. Goda kunskaper om egenvård av barn med feber kan troligtvis förhindra en del besök till akutmottagning. 

Abstract [en]

Background: In children aged zero to five years, fever is a common symptom of illness. It is therefore essential that the caregiver understands the importance of self-care to effectively care for their child at home. Aim: The aim was to illuminate the preventive efforts of the child health care nurse for children with fever. Method: The chosen method was qualitative design with an inductive approach. Interviews of 11 specialist nurses including district nurses and nurses with specialist training in health care of children and adolescents. Child health Care nurses (CHC nurses) in both private and regional management participated from two municipalities in Halland. Results: Three categories: Information to guardians, support to guardians and self-care counselling constituted the result. Subcategories were then added. Similar results have been seen in participating child health nurses. Conclusion: The conclusion was that the majority of the child health care nurses felt there was a significant need for self-care education regarding children with fever for caregivers. Good knowledge of self-care of children with fever can probably prevent some visits to the emergency department.
